Home foundation leveling services involve assessing and correcting uneven or settling foundations to restore stability and structural integrity. This process typically includes identifying areas where the foundation has shifted or sunk, then implementing methods such as piering, underpinning, or slab jacking to raise and stabilize the foundation. These services aim to address issues caused by so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or other environmental factors that can impact a property's foundation over time. Proper foundation leveling helps ensure the home remains safe, level, and structurally sound.
The primary problems addressed by foundation leveling services include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ible foundation cracks. These issues often result from shifting soil or settlement that causes the foundation to settle unevenly. Left unaddressed, such problems can lead to further structural damage, increased repair costs, and potential safety hazards. Foundation leveling services help mitigate these risks by restoring the foundation to its proper position, thereby preventing further deterioration and maintaining the property's overall stability.
Properties that typically utilize foundation leveling services range from residential homes to small commercial buildings. Single-family houses, especially those on expansive or clay-rich soils, are common candidates for foundation correction. Older homes with signs of settlement or structural movement often require leveling to prevent worsening damage. Additionally, properties experiencing ongoing soil movement or those built on poorly compacted ground may also benefit from foundation stabilization to maintain their structural integrity over time.

Foundation Repair Costs - The average cost for home foundation leveling services typically ranges from $3,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of the damage and the size of the property. For example, minor adjustments may be closer to $2,500, while extensive repairs could exceed $10,000.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Per-Foundation Pricing - Many service providers charge between $1,000 and $3,000 per section or pier used in foundation leveling. Smaller homes or minor adjustments might fall on the lower end, whereas larger or more complex projects tend to be at the higher end of the spectrum. Costs vary based on foundation type and accessibility.
Factors Influencing Cost - The total expense for foundation leveling can vary due to factors such as soil conditions, foundation type, and property size. For example, homes with expansive clay soils may require more extensive work, increasing costs. Local contractors can assess site-specific factors to provide accurate pricing.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s may include permits, structural repairs, or additional stabilization measures, which can add several thousand dollars to the project. For instance, underpinning or crack repairs might increase the overall budget beyond initial estimates. Contact local pros for comprehensive cost assessments.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of a foundation that needs leveling?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ors or windows that stick or don’t close properly, and gaps around window or door frames.
How do professionals typically perform foundation leveling? Contractors may use methods such as mudjacking or polyurethane foam injections to lift and stabilize the foundation, depending on the situation.
Is foundation leveling a disruptive process? The extent of disruption varies; some methods are minimally invasive, while others may require minor excavation or interior work. Local pros can provide guidance based on specific needs.
How long does a typical foundation leveling service take? The duration depends on the size and severity of the issue, but most projects are completed within a few days.
